Naphthalene is a simple pol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on, and is naturally available in white crystalline form. The organic compound structure consists of a fused pair of benzene rings. It is known as a prime ingredient for traditional mothballs. It is volatile and sublimes slowly at room temperature.
Naphthalene is derived from coal tar and petroleum fractions during refining. Artificially synthesized naphthalene compounds is used as precursors in the production of other chemicals. Naphthalene sulfonic acids are used in synthesis of dyestuffs and pharmaceuticals, among others. It also finds applications in several end-use industries, including textile, building & construction, rubber, and agrochemicals.

Coal tar segment to account a considerable market share
Based on sources, the market is bifurcated into coal tar and petroleum. The coal tar segment is anticipated to account for a considerable market share during the forecast period. Coal tar is a volatile product that is formed from the destructive distillation of coal, and produced through modern processes, which includes high-temperature cracking that is breaking up of large molecules of petroleum. It is commercially produced by crystallization from the intermediate fraction of condensed coal tar and from the heavier fraction of cracked petroleum.
Naphthalene sulfonates to hold a major market share
Based on applications, the global naphthalene market is divided into phthalic anhydride, naphthalene sulfonates, low-volatility solvents, moth repellent, pesticides, and others. The naphthalene sulfonates segment is expected to hold a major market share during the forecast period owing to its excellent water reducing ability in concrete admixtures. It is also used as a superplasticizer in concrete admixtures. Increasing demand for high-grade concrete that provides stability, tensile strength, and is cost effective in nature is expected to propel the segment growth.
